Have the curse client been fixed?

Due to the new block of WoWMatrix, I'm considering testing out Curse Client again. I will not install it without asking some questions in advance however.

 

1. Do it still include a spyware addon? I think it's called Profiler or something similar. When I last installed Curse Client this addon was installed automaticly, and uploaded information without my concent. While it was possible to stop the addon from running, it still installed without asking me. This is the definition of spyware. Does the current client still do this, or am I asked before installing?

 

2. Can I now uninstall addons manually? While I last used Curce Client I manually removed all my addons to build myself a new interface. However, when I started Curse Client it noticed that these addons were missing, and re-installed them for me - something that I did not want. The only way to avoid this that I found would have been to uninstalling the addons using Curse Client. Obviously I didn't do this, but instead removed the client.

 

3. Do Curse Client still download outdated addons? Last time Curse Client "updated" several of my addons with old version, as I had newer versions from other sites (independant or from WoWInsider). This caused my whole UI to be broken. Do this still happen, or is there some kind of Toc check to avoid this?

1) the profiler, isn't malware, it's a feature many users want.  You can however disable it during installation

2) Those types of behaviors are much improved, I don't expect you'd have any issues.

3) It downloads the most up to date on curse.com.  If we don't recognize the version you have we won't touch it.
